Transaction 2bac96a40203657f74dfe3e08103d232ad83a6ae86bfc64d64db58e1008ca39f
1 Input
1 Output
-
2bac96a40203657f74dfe3e08103d232ad83a6ae86bfc64d64db58e1008ca39f:0
- value
- 27818
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 35fcf16b27dc97f03c3b832d25fa028524d64355 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15vTpxYU3Rgh88JTD14SpEDX8HMX5aRLFQ